Transaction 76119ceb6eff599fb1fa866de809ffea5b4ca0fb2186d18d0f9faf0128558842
1 Input
1 Output
-
76119ceb6eff599fb1fa866de809ffea5b4ca0fb2186d18d0f9faf0128558842:0
- value
- 306622
- script pubkey
- OP_0 OP_PUSHBYTES_20 38ba2e349e083f8c683e71cd50b88766e4510974
- address
- bc1q8zazudy7pqlcc6p7w8x4pwy8vmj9zzt57kl2af